Summary
The Older Person's Same Day Emergency Care (SDEC) is an established service delivering care to suitable older patients.
The main aim of the service is to rapidly assess, diagnose and treat older patients within the same day, improving their patient journey and avoiding inpatient hospital admission where possible.

Working within same day emergency care clinic for older people.
Assisting ACP team and working alongside registered nurse in the delivery of rapid assessment and turn around of older people presenting to the acute hospital.
Main duties include (with training as required) :-
> recording vital signs, ECG's, postural blood pressures, weight of patients
> Venepuncture and cannulation
> Nutrition and fluid intake of patients
> Toileting and personal care
> Portering of patients to different departments for investigations
> Arranging transport
> Working as part of the MDT
